Scope note
Objects containing sacred Jewish scriptures. The term Tanakh is an acronym based on the primary letters of the work's three major components: the Torah or Pentateuch, the Nevi'im (meaning Prophets), and the Ketuvim (meaning Writings). The Tanakh is also the source for the Old Testament, a component of the Christian Bible. Has been reproduced in the format of oral histories, scrolls, codices, and books. Some codices and scrolls, from the 11th century CE and earlier, are illuminated with scrollwork, geometric designs, and micrography.
